Crews searching for missing 18-year-old kayaker at Benbrook Lake, officials say

Crews with the Texas Parks and Wildlife Department and local first responders have been searching for a missing kayaker at Benbrook Lake since about 10:15 a.m. Tuesday, officials said.

Three people were aboard one kayak when an incident occurred and caused all three people to fall into the water, according to a statement from Texas Parks and Wildlife.

Two of the people were able to swim to shore, but the third person, an 18-year-old man, did not resurface, according to the statement.

Crews have been searching for the missing man since receiving the call, officials said.

The Benbrook Fire Department said in a social media post that the search would resume on Wednesday morning. A dive team from the Fort Worth Fire Department, Benbrook police, park rangers from the Army Corps of Engineers and game wardens from the state parks department also were assisting with the search, according to the post.
